Shavonte Zellous’ 3-pointer 30 seconds earlier gave the Mystics (10-15) their first lead of the night at 54-53 after trailing 35-19 at the half. Natasha Cloud scored all 21 of her points in the second half and helped fuel a furious second-half rally that propelled the Washington Mystics to a 76-75 victory over the Dallas Wings Saturday in the nation’s capital. Dallas (11-15) sought its second consecutive win and seemed to be on its way after a smothering first half. The Mystics, who had dropped nine of their last 11, came in needing a win to keep their playoff hopes alive. The Wings shot 75 percent from the floor in the first on their way to a 17-9 lead and dominated the second quarter.
